Once a Gang Location has been established Log Grades (WoodTypes) are required to be allocated to create the Stock Items against the location.
Log Grades can be added in several ways,
Manually added one at a time
Copied from a previous location
Added by the addition of Weekly Uplift Requests (WUR) or Production Estimates
From addition by Loader PDT app (WSX Mobile)
To manually add Log Grades to a Gang Location,
Click on an existing Log Grade in the required location or if the location currently has no log grades assigned you will need to first select it by clicking on the 'Select Loc' button and selecting from the 'Select Gang Location' screen.
Note: Gang Locations that have no Log Grades assigned will not display in the Stock Calls screen. Once you have selected a new location it displays in the Stock Calls screen as basically blank, i.e. no stock line items display and the likes of the Gang Location Comment, Location Comment, Name, Coordinates, etc., are all blank. As soon as you add a log grade data will populate in these fields where present.
2. Select the Insert Key on the keyboard or right click on the stock area and select 'Insert Stock'. From the 'Select a WoodType Record' screen that presents, highlight the required Log Grade (you can locate the log grade by typing in the screen) and select the Enter key or click the 'Select' button to add.
Once selected the Log Grade will then display in the Stock Calls screen associated to the selected Gang Location. This item can then be edited to add the likes of Stock Quantity, Fell Date, and Comments - see Taking a Stock Call guide (write and link).

This function allows you to copy Log Grades that exist at most recent previous location, to the most current location, i.e. copy from the second most recent location to the newest location (Note: Locations display and are ordered by their associated 'Order Date').
To copy Log Grades from the previous location
Click on an existing Log Grade in the required location or if the location currently has no log grades assigned you will need to first select it by clicking on the 'Select Loc' button and selecting from the 'Select Gang Location' screen.
Note: Gang Locations that have no Log Grades assigned will not display in the Stock Calls screen. Once you have selected a new location it display in the Stock Calls screen as basically 'blank', i.e. no stock line items display and the likes of the Gang Location Comment, Location Comment, Name, Coordinates, etc., are all blank. As soon as you add a log grade data will populate in these fields where present.
2. Click on the 'Copy Last' button. This will copy from the last most current location all Log Grades that are currently active at that location. This copy will add the Log Grades to the new location, but does not copy any of the Stocky Quantity, Fell Date or Comment data.
Note: Active does not mean has a Stock Quantity greater than zero, simply that it exists against the location.

The ability to automatically add Stock Items to Gang Locations on the addition of Weekly Uplift Request or Production Estimate data also exists.
This function is controlled by the DB Setting AutoAddStockLine_LogOrg, whereby if WUR or Production Estimate data is added for a Gang Location where the Log Grade does not already exist as a Stock Item and the setting is,
Activated - Adds a stock item to the Gang Location (with zero stock quantity values)
Not Activated - Only adds a stock item if this option is manually selected when adding or editing the WUR or Production Estimate item
Where a Gang has a PDT running WSX Mobile they can utilise this both for stock calls and also to add new Log Grades to a location. See the Crew PDT section for information how this is undertaken on the PDT.
